1 – Disney Announces 5 Huge Announcements That Will Make Guests Happy

This week Disney announced five announcements that seek to improve the guest experience at Walt Disney World. Since the parks reopening in July 2020, visiting the parks has had its challenges, and guests have given feedback on how those policies affect their experiences and vacations. The good news is Disney is listening and adjusting. First up, park reservations will no longer be required for date-based tickets beginning in early 2024. Second, while annual passholders will still need park reservations on most days, Disney has announced “Good-to-go-days” for passholders and Cast Members. On these days, they will not need park reservations. Third, the popular Disney Dining Plans will return in early 2024. Forth, Early Theme Park entry, a perk for Walt Disney World resort guests, will be extended for visits through 2024 as well as, Extended Evening Hours for guests staying at Disney Deluxe Resorts and Deluxe Villas. Fifth, Disney has announced plans to simplify the Disney Genie+ service and Individual Lighting Lane selections by enabling guests to choose their selections before the day of their visit. All of these offerings will improve guest experiences. Finally, 2024 resort packages will go on sale on May 31! Learn more at the link below.

5 – Mother’s Day Luau at Morimoto Asia

On Mother’s Day, we enjoyed a wonderful lunch at Morimoto Asia. The Mother’s Day Luau is an annual event that features delicious food, Hawaiian entertainment, and more. The food selection was wide, with a variety of Hawaiian-inspired poke and sushi, shrimp, Morimoto-style baby ribs (our favorite of the day), a whole roasted pig, and delicious desserts. The entertainment added to the atmosphere of the lunch, and it was very special! Morimoto holds events like these throughout the year. Be on the lookout for the next one. 6 – New Menu Items for Space 220

Space 220 Restaurant, the out-of-this-world dining experience at Walt Disney World’s EPCOT, has just added some stellar new dishes to its menu, awaiting guests a simulated 220 miles above the Earth. The new offerings now available are:

Lift-Offs (Appetizers)

    • Seafood Cannelloni “Rockets” – shrimp, scallops, snapper, saffron cream sauce, salmon caviar, chives
    • Neptuna Tartare –  sushi grade yellowfin tuna, avocado crema, mango coulis, edamame, wonton crisp, yuzu dressing
    • Roasted Asparagus Soup – jumbo lump crabmeat, roasted poblano and red peppers, citrus chili oil, crouton

Star Course (Entrées)

    • Tomahawk Pork Chop – slow roasted 16 oz Niman Ranch pork chop, corn flan, succotash, spiced applesauce
    • Pan Roasted Swordfish “Cioppino” – shrimp, littleneck clams, prince edward island mussels, tomato fennel seafood broth, toasted garlic bread

Supernova Sweets (Dessert)

    • Vanilla Bean Greek Yogurt Parfait – black sesame crumble, yuzu curd, macerated blackberries, basil blackberry sauce
    • Cosmic Cupcake (Kid’s Menu) – chocolate vegan devil’s food cake topped with vanilla frosting & galactic sprinkles
    • Fruity Pebbles Cereal Rocket Pop (Kid’s Menu) – fruity pebbles, marshmallow, chocolate rocket

7 – Chicken Guy! Seasonal Milkshake Now Available

Chicken Guy!, the fast-casual restaurant by TV personality and celebrity chef Guy Fieri has debuted a sweet treat available for a limited time at locations nationwide. Just in time for spring, the restaurant is offering the new Huckleberry Shake, made with creamy, hand-spun vanilla soft serve and mixed berry puree, topped off with fresh whipped cream and Cinnamon Toast Crumble. It will be available through June 25.
